User:Jmandel/WRF-Vistrails user interface suggestions

From openwfm
Jump to navigation Jump to search
  1. in vistrails, input the directories by navigating to them in the usual fashion as all other mac programs, but leave the option to type/cut/paste if possible
  2. a box with an error message should pop up if something is wrong with the path or the files
  3. the vistrails window should remain responsive during the conversion, show a progress bar and a cancel button, not just freeze up
  4. a box with an error message should pop up if something goes wrong with the conversion
  5. there should be some sort of altert (a dialog box in front?) when the conversion is done. I need to do other things while it is working and the vistrails window gets buried somewhere
  6. the "Fire demo visualization" should already know where the vtk files are, not ask again (or it should prefill the choice with the known location)
  7. make it simple to recover or backtrack when something goes wrong, including wrong user input. Make every step guaranteed re-runnable. I had to start from the scratch (exist vistrails, start again...) every single time when I messed up, which was quite often.
  8. Why all those boxes? A scientist probably does not care about the details, certainly not the first time. Just show the user one big button, the user will push the button, navigate to the directory with the wrfout files, watch the progress bar for a while, and then watch the movie. Or at most two buttons (convert, visualize), and make it clear in some dialog box or in the howto how to save and visualize the next time without converting again.
  9. There should be online help, or a help button to start the preview of the pdf of the manual. The pdf should be installed in the VisTrails application directory, where VisTrails.app is.
  10. it needs to be clear how to start a spreadsheet. The spreadsheet should pop up and not hide under the vistrails window.
  11. the axes in the visualization should be labeled and the current time displayed in every frame, please.
  12. The control buttons on the bottom should give some feedback when pressed. The movie reacts slowly (or not at all at times), so it is not clear what is happening
  13. The user interface is a bit raw and doing strange things at times. The look and feel should be the same as other native Mac applications. Probably VisTrails is not using the right Mac library for the GUI?
  14. The GUI should be really simplified to get the user hooked the first time: simple useful things should be done in a simple way, without studying anything. Then, if someone wants to get deeper, they can do that later.
  15. The Howto should say how to save the movie as a file.
  16. I'd like to display the heat flux instead of/in addition to the area burned (I think that's what vistrails displays now). Please see the attached pictures. (This is from a new feature, ignition points moving along lines over time.) Vistrails has some artefacts but I know do not have the current version of the files. Will retest after I get it.
  17. It would be good to have some usual options, best from drop-down menus, such as: selection of variables, colors, transparency, start/stop time, play in a loop or not, add legends, labels, colorbars, etc.
  18. I could not find controls for rewind/advance and start/stop capture to a movie file.
  19. I can see the ultimate goal may include the server in a kiosk mode, with the user just pushing buttons and choosing from menus, with all the details of the internal working and anything the user could mess up hidden and disabled?
  20. What is animation delay, please?
  21. I would be nice if the controls are not be visible in captured images/movies.
  22. during the conversion, vistrails seemed to disable other windows or steal focus from them (Chrome, in particular, where I am writing this)
  23. After the conversion, the vtk were nowhere to be found (I did not create the directory, but Vistrains did not complain and just went ahead with the conversion?)
  24. it was not clear what exactly it means "View the spread sheet to interact with the visualization" in the howto. I forgot since the last time. There is no button labeled "spreadsheet". The manual says something about main menu or spreadsheet toolbar but I did not see any such things in the vistrails window either. I was afraid to try and push random buttons for fear I would get to some state I could not recover from, and I would have to start all over again (another hour or so). Eventually, I accidentally found the spreadsheet hiding under the vistrails window.